Introduction
The Celer-series is Teldat's next generation multi-service communications platform for vehicles. It provides 5G/4G Wi-Fi 6 broadband, secure connectivity with Teldat's next generation firewall, artificial intelligence applications with Google's Coral and eSIM for remote SIM provisioning via Teldat's SENDA (Service for ENhanced Deployment & Administration) service.
ITxPT should be understood as an agreement between many public transport stakeholders to enable digitalization and integration of mobility services, defines interoperability on 3 levels, hardware, communication protocols, and service level.

Description
Celer-Series is the best way to have onboard high performance conectivity protected with a strong OT IDS/IPS next generation firewall. With this features not only provides secure Wi-Fi service to the passengers but also secure networks for the bus operators in use cases like, onboard cameras, ticketing data, tracking services for positioning information and geofences.
Is compatible with the Teldat's zero touch provisioning and out-of-band eSIM management service application SENDA (Service for ENhanced Deployment & Administration). With SENDA you can select edge devices, enhanced deployment (universal zero-touch provisioning) and management (out-of-band administration), allowing device provisioning, management and troubleshooting, even in the event of total customer network failure.
Aditionally Celer-Series has AI embeded with Google Coral, with use cases like computer vision, predictive manteinance, and some others...
Key Features
5G NR, higher performance and improved efficiency empower new user experiences and connects new industries.
Multi service BT 5.1 to configure the router and various functions such as connection of sensors or on-board accessories.
Via TPU (Tensor Processing Unit) embedded Google Coral for dedicated applications such as video processing (Computer Vision), predictive maintenance and many other AI applications.
Dual SIM for each port to increase connection availability, using any telecommunications operator as a backup for the others in case of connection loss in a single module and eSIM availability to zero-touch provisioning.
Ideal for fleet management or telemarketing applications. The equipment has GPS accessible via TCP port that provides real-time geolocation information in NMEA standard.
Multi user 2x2 MiMo dual band Wi-Fi that seamless integrates with HotSpot and WebFilter applications, creating a full solution for on-board Internet connectivity.
Teldat's Security Solutions of Operational Technology to on-board systems.
Extended temperature range (-25ºC to 70ºC). Anti-vibration design. 12-24 VDC for connection to batteries with optimising battery consumption capabilities.
Power supply protection and ignition detection for delayed shutdown. Minimisation of failures due to unstable power supply. Temperature sensor for automatic shutdown.
